HRGB_CJRS005 - Details

  • The SAP error message HRGB_CJRS005 indicates that the system cannot find a Personal Details (0002) record for the employee on the specified date. This error typically arises in the context of HR processes, such as payroll or personnel administration, where the system requires certain employee data to be present.
    
    Cause: Missing Personal Details Record: The employee does not have a valid Personal Details (0002) record for the date in question. This could be due to: The record was never created. The record was deleted or not saved properly. The record is not valid for the specified date (e.g., the employee was not active). Incorrect Date: The date being referenced may not correspond to a period when the employee was active or had a Personal Details record. Data Entry Errors: There may have been errors during data entry that resulted in the absence of the required record.
